Trinidad and Tobago Opposition Leader, Kamla Persad-Bissessar is staying true to her recent form  and has channeled her inner Donald Trump by calling on Prime Minister Dr Keith Rowley to completly re-open the country by next week. If you have been living under a rock, Donald Trump is the United States President who shares the same "time to open everything up now" philosophy in defiance of the threat of the COVID-19 virus that has claimed more than hundred thousand lives in his country. Now Kamla is taking a page from Trump's playbook and has released a public statement on social media blasting the Rowley government, stating in her letter that citizens and businesses are suffering under the current COVID-19 restrictions.

Her plea to the Prime Minister comes as the country is quickly approaching one month since the last recorded positive case of COVID-19. In her same statement released on Facebook she mentions "The hunger crisis, mass unemployment and threats of homelessness and impoverishment for so many citizens that has ensued is a shocking  
 wake up call." 

She went on to blast the government for taking too long to re-open the manufacturing sector saying it was long overdue and highly insufficient. She believed the severe economic fallout faced by many small and medium term businesses during what she labels as the government's prolonged national shutdown has condieabley endangered T&T's overall economic viability. She went on declare "I am therefore calling on Prime Minister Rowley to endure that the entire country is re-opend by next week"

 However it is important for our readers here on Soca Music Tv to understand that the Rowley led government has developed and rolled out a phase opening plan for Trinidad and Tobago. As of today the country is currently in the second phase of re-opening.

On the other hand the government has continued to receive praise at home and abroad for their managing of the COVID-19 virus in the twin island Republic.  Mandating early and strict safety guidelines from nation-wide lockdown procedures  to stay at home measures, the government's leadership for the rest of the nation has bear fruit in helping contain the deadly virus. They have continued to gain praise for their results, from foreign nationals writing open letters to the world, to the Chinese government noticing their efforts and as of yesterday the people of T&T can stand proud together knowing they have zero active cases.
